diff options
author | Eugene Susla <eugenesusla@google.com> | 2019-09-11 13:46:09 -0700 |
---|---|---|
committer | Eugene Susla <eugenesusla@google.com> | 2019-09-11 13:58:34 -0700 |
commit | 71d5e7775e7df89bdbccc1de5ebb6f4742dc760f (patch) | |
tree | d63602d3426fb49466e10904388b056f99cea282 /tools/codegen | |
parent | aa62e30c8de04babf26483cf8e2bbdf5a2632211 (diff) |
Fix codegen not accepting relative paths
Fixes: 140886378
Test: codegen tests/Codegen/src/com/android/codegentest/SampleDataClass.java;
./frameworks/base/tests/Codegen/runTest.sh
Change-Id: Ie2b5c55f35ec7865bf34cf9e99ef7751eb5f8d98
Diffstat (limited to 'tools/codegen')
-rwxr-xr-x | tools/codegen/src/com/android/codegen/Main.kt | 2 | ||||
-rw-r--r-- | tools/codegen/src/com/android/codegen/SharedConstants.kt |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/tools/codegen/src/com/android/codegen/Main.kt b/tools/codegen/src/com/android/codegen/Main.kt index 0f932f3c34e1..fa2b41adcacb 100755 --- a/tools/codegen/src/com/android/codegen/Main.kt +++ b/tools/codegen/src/com/android/codegen/Main.kt @@ -107,7 +107,7 @@ fun main(args: Array<String>) { println(CODEGEN_VERSION) System.exit(0) } - val file = File(args.last()) + val file = File(args.last()).absoluteFile val sourceLinesNoClosingBrace = file.readLines().dropLastWhile { it.startsWith("}") || it.all(Char::isWhitespace) } diff --git a/tools/codegen/src/com/android/codegen/SharedConstants.kt b/tools/codegen/src/com/android/codegen/SharedConstants.kt index 7d50ad10de00..b2cc81391510 100644 --- a/tools/codegen/src/com/android/codegen/SharedConstants.kt +++ b/tools/codegen/src/com/android/codegen/SharedConstants.kt @@ -1,7 +1,7 @@ package com.android.codegen const val CODEGEN_NAME = "codegen" -const val CODEGEN_VERSION = "1.0.0" +const val CODEGEN_VERSION = "1.0.1" const val CANONICAL_BUILDER_CLASS = "Builder" const val BASE_BUILDER_CLASS = "BaseBuilder" |